New Reactor Project Quality Engineer (Remote Eligible, U.S.)

Remote · USA Full-time New today

Job Description

Summary The Project Quality Engineer will be responsible for executing project quality activities for GEH Advanced Nuclear projects

Job Description

Essential Responsibilities Perform quality activities for Advanced Nuclear projects to ensure compliance with regulatory, customer, and GEH requirements Support project execution for procured products Work with suppliers to define quality requirements, inspection and verification processes, qualification activities, and test controls Provide technical guidance to suppliers to ensure compliance with drawings and specifications Resolve supplier quality issues and disposition nonconforming product Execute supplier quality surveillance activities for New Reactor programs Write and review quality documents, plans, and procedures Support corrective action and error prevention efforts

Required Qualifications

Associate’s degree from an accredited college/university, or High School Diploma/GED with 8+ years of nuclear industry experience 4+ years of experience in engineering, manufacturing, manufacturing engineering support, or nuclear quality assurance 2+ years of experience in a nuclear quality role Strong understanding of nuclear safety culture Experience with NDE processes, ASME Code requirements, welding issues, and quality inspections Familiarity with electrical/electronic standards, control systems, software-based protection systems, PLC/SCADA, and related testing methods Knowledge of ASME NQA-1, CSA N299, CSA N285, and ISO 9001 Must be willing to travel to supplier and customer sites as required, up to 40% Preferred work location is GEH Headquarters in Wilmington, NC; highly qualified U.S.-based remote candidates will be considered Desired Qualifications Demonstrated self-starter possessing strong initiative and teamwork skills.
